Output e73577622635b35c7791161f8ff18fed935d9cadad32a9407d3d69450b2da4ca:0

value
104652667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cfc8d017633b41fe81b64fe3ceb67d86583a365 OP_EQUAL
address
34LHPTCM77LetcQsUWZ3T743g5Q3DLzNJf
transaction
e73577622635b35c7791161f8ff18fed935d9cadad32a9407d3d69450b2da4ca
confirmations
511670
spent
true